Material and quality of tailoring

The first thing to pay attention to before choose military pants, is a fabric. As a rule, brands sew army pants from the following materials:

  1. Cotton. It makes soft, breathable clothes that are suitable for warm weather, but has the disadvantage of wearing out quickly.
  2. Ripstop. A durable, reinforced material that is resistant to tearing. It is ideal for hiking and field work.
  3. Blends. These variations contain both natural and synthetic fibers. Clothing made from blended fabrics is the optimal balance of comfort and durability. It also dries quickly and does not fade. Such a fabric has many advantages.

When inspecting a tactical model, pay attention to reinforced seams in areas of maximum load (knees, buttocks), and the presence of knee pads to protect the fabric.

Cut, fit and functional details

Special pants are often sewn in three versions: slim (straight, tight-fitting), regular (classic) and cargo (loose with lots of pockets).

  1. Slim emphasize the figure and fit into a minimalist urban look.
  2. Regular is a versatile option for everyday wear.
  3. Cargo – military style with side patch pockets. Great for hiking, fishing, and hunting.

All of these options are suitable for belts in a concise military style.

In addition to the cut, the following details are important in the product: the number of pockets (4–6), fasteners (zipper or buttons), drawstrings at the waist and bottom of the pants, and elastic inserts for freedom of movement.

What to wear with tactical pants

To make the camouflage look harmonious, choose neutral clothing on top and discreet accessories. This design is suitable for any conditions.

Camouflage pants for active recreation go well with basic items. For a discreet look, choose a fitted white T-shirt and a thin bomber or denim jacket. If you want a rougher look, wear leather boots or berets and a tight shirt with a small print. For a sporty look, choose sneakers with a massive sole and a hoodie. It is important to maintain a balance when buying camouflage pants in a military store:

  1. A solid-colored top will soften the aggressiveness of the camouflage, and minimalism in accessories will emphasize practicality.
  2. Avoid colorful prints on top to avoid creating “color chaos.” Camouflage is already an accent in itself.
  3. Don't choose models that are too loose, they can create a "pile of fabric" near the knees.
  4. Avoid cheap replicas with bright, artificial prints – they quickly fade and crack. Don’t pair khaki pants with overly saturated patterns on top – it looks messy.
